开放服务器端口:步骤详解,确保安全畅通无阻!
如何开放服务器端口

首页 2024-06-25 18:29:26



如何开放服务器端口:专业步骤与注意事项 在服务器管理中,开放端口是一项常见且必要的操作,它允许外部设备或网络访问服务器上的特定服务

    然而,不当的端口开放操作可能带来安全风险,因此必须遵循一定的专业步骤和注意事项

    本文将详细介绍如何安全、有效地开放服务器端口

     一、确定需开放的端口及其服务 在开放端口之前,必须明确需要开放哪些端口以及这些端口对应的服务

    这需要根据服务器的用途和业务需求来确定

    例如,如果服务器需要提供Web服务,那么通常需要开放80端口(HTTP)和443端口(HTTPS)

    如果服务器用作邮件服务器,则需要开放25端口(SMTP)、110端口(POP3)和143端口(IMAP)等

     二、了解端口的潜在风险 在决定开放哪些端口之前,必须对这些端口的潜在风险有清晰的认识

    一些端口可能更容易受到攻击或滥用,因此需要采取额外的安全措施

    例如,开放SSH端口(通常为22端口)可以方便远程管理服务器,但同时也增加了暴力破解和未授权访问的风险

    因此,在开放这些端口时,应使用强密码、限制访问IP地址范围或启用两步验证等安全措施

     三、配置防火墙规则 在确定了需要开放的端口及其服务后,下一步是配置服务器的防火墙规则

    防火墙是保护服务器安全的第一道防线,通过配置防火墙规则,可以控制哪些IP地址或网络可以访问服务器的哪些端口

     在配置防火墙规则时,应遵循“最小权限原则”,即只开放必要的端口,并限制访问权限

    具体来说,可以指定允许访问的IP地址范围、协议类型(TCP或UDP)以及端口号

    同时,应定期审查和更新防火墙规则,确保它们仍然符合业务需求和安全策略

     四、使用安全组或ACLs进行访问控制 除了防火墙规则外,还可以使用安全组或访问控

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道